Background: Hypercoagulability, complement activation and endothelial perturbation characterize sever COVID-19. After disease remission, a proportion of convalescent subjects still experience post-COVID-19 symptoms. No information is available on persistence of hemostatic alterations in this setting. Bergamo city, represents one of the first and most affected area by SARS-CoV-2 infection in the world. For this reason, since the beginning we were actively involved in recruiting CCP donors. Aims: In a large cohort of CCP donors, we aimed to characterize biomarkers of hypercoagulability and of endothelial perturbation in order to find associations with disease severity, demographic characteristics, and anti-SARS-CoV-2 antibody levels. Methods : Candidate CCP donors were tested for the anti-SARSCoV-2 antibodies, including anti-S IgG antibodies (Anti-S Ab) and anti-N IgG antibodies (Anti-N Ab). In addition, the following plasma biomarkers were assessed: fibrinogen, protein C, protein S, factor V, factor VIII, factor XIII, D-dimer, and von Willebrand factor (vWF). Results: 425 CCP candidates (275M/150F, age range 19-67 years) were admitted to donation. Male gender, age > 40 years, and severe form of COVID-19 were identified as independent predictors of high levels of both anti-S and anti-N Ab ( p <0.001). Among hemostatic parameters, levels of vWF antigen, vWF activity and protein C were significantly higher in CCP donors who had severe COVID-19 compared to donors who had non-severe COVID-19 ( p <0.001). Furthermore, vWF levels positively correlated with anti-S Ab levels (vWF-antigen r=0.216 vWF-activity r=0.257 and vWFRiCof r=0.226, p <0.01). Conclusions: Our data show that gender, age and severe disease can be predictors of an increased immunological response. Furthermore, convalescent subjects show a persistently high vWF levels, suggesting a persistence of the endothelial activation, despite of clinical disease remission.
Background: Acquired thrombotic thrombocytopenic purpura (aTTP) is an immune-mediated life-threatening thrombotic microangiopathy (TMA). Daily therapeutic plasma exchange (TPE) and the optimized use of rituximab have dramatically improved the overall prognosis, however the rate of disease recurrence remains high. Acute-phase treatment and specific predictors of relapse can be relevant for an optimal patient management. Aims: In a large multicenter cohort of aTTP patients, we aimed to analyze the effect of acute-phase treatment on disease recurrence and to identify predictive variables of relapse. Methods: From 2002 to 2018, 325 TMA were referred to our Centers. A complete ADAMTS13 activity deficiency (<10%) was diagnostic for TTP in 163 patients. An anti-ADAMTS13 Ab titer >15U/L was considered positive and identified aTTP cases. Seventy-four aTTP patients with complete medical records were enrolled into the study and prospectively monitored. Complete response (CR) to treatment was defined as platelets >150x109/L for >2 days and LDH normalization, lasting for 30 days; a suboptimal response included exacerbation (EX) = recurrent disease within 30 days after reaching CR; and refractoriness (REF) = no treatment response by day 30. Results: aTTP patient characteristics at diagnosis are shown in the Table. Sixty-three patients were evaluated for treatment response. Two (3%) early deaths were due to myocardial infarction and diffuse rectal ischemia after 7 and 10 days from diagnosis, respectively. Forty patients (64%) obtained a CR after a median time to response (mTTR) of 10 days and a median number of TPE (mTPE) of 7; 21 (33%) obtained a suboptimal response: 13 EX (mTTR 31 days, mTPE 13), and 8 REF (mTTR 42.5, mTPE 19). Thirteen patients with a suboptimal response to TPE were treated with rituximab, all obtaining CR. TTR to 1st line treatment <13 days significantly correlated with a sustained CR (p = 0.004). At remission, 57% of patients showed normal levels (>50%) of ADAMTS13 activity, while 20% a moderate (21–50%), 10% a severe (10–20%), and 11% a complete (<10%) deficiency. A complete or partial recovery of ADAMTS13 activity was associated to negative Ab levels in 90% of cases. Twenty-one patients (34%) relapsed, 14 of them had multiple relapses. Median follow-up was 7 years. Patients were evaluated for predictive parameters of disease recurrence. By multivariate analysis, the association of ADAMTS13 activity ≤20% with a high anti-ADAMTS-13 titer during remission, and a TTR to 1st line treatment ≥13 days, were independent prognostic factors of relapse (p = 0.003 and p = 0.004, respectively). Furthermore, the use of rituximab in patients with a suboptimal TPE response significantly reduced relapse rate (p = 0.002). By Cox regression analysis, patients with ADAMTS13 activity ≤20% plus anti-ADAMTS13 Ab titer >15U/L at remission had an increased risk of relapse (HR 1.98, CI 95% 1.087–3.614; p < 0.02).Summary/Conclusion: In conclusion, our study shows that the association of a low ADAMTS13 activity with high anti-ADAMTS13 antibodies is highly predictive of disease relapse. Moreover, a shorter time to 1st line CR achievement and the salvage use of rituximab in suboptimal responders to TPE significantly reduces relapse. These observations support the use of new therapeutic strategies able to provide faster responses to 1st line TPE treatment in these patients.
The aim of this study was to evaluate the acute effects of transdermal nitroglycerin on the sympathetic and renin-angiotensin-aldosterone systems activity, in a group of patients with stable exercise induced angina pectoris. Eighteen outpatients (15M, 3F, age range 47-65 years) were included in this double-blind, randomized, crossover trial comparing the antianginal effects of a transdermal system delivering 20 mg.day-1 of nitroglycerin to an identical placebo. Plasma renin activity, plasma aldosterone and catecholamine concentrations were measured in resting basal conditions and at 4, 8, 24, and 32 h post-dosing. Patients were subdivided in two groups according to the increase in exercise duration after patch application greater than 30% (responders, n = 8) and less or equal to 30% (non-responders, n = 10) in respect to placebo. In responders plasma norepinephrine was slightly increased during transdermal nitroglycerin administration in comparison to placebo while no change was observed in plasma adrenaline and aldosterone concentrations and in plasma renin activity. In non-responders plasma norepinephrine levels significantly increased during nitroglycerin treatment in comparison with placebo. Multiple comparisons showed that this increase was significant at 4, 8 and 24 h post-dosing. Plasma epinephrine and aldosterone concentrations and plasma renin activity were also increased after nitroglycerin administration. The case of a patient with large pseudoaneurysm of the mitral-aortic intervalvular fibrosa following a blunt chest trauma is presented. A two dimensional echocardiographic study revealed a large aneurysmal sac situated between the posterior aortic root and the left atrium, which expanded in systole and partially collapsed in diastole. An echo-free space which represented the mouth of the aneurysm was seen just below the posterior aortic cusp in the junctional zone between the two valves, called mitral-aortic intervalvular fibrosa. Nuclear magnetic resonance imaging showed a better resolution of the echocardiographic feature. Cardiac catheterization and surgery confirmed the diagnosis.
The authors relate their own experience with 24 hr Holter monitoring in course of cardiac rehabilitation after coronary bypass surgery as well as after valvular replacement. As regards patients after coronary surgery they report the experience they got in the evaluation of heart rate trend and cardiac arrhythmias as well as in silent ischemia study. About this last problem 116 patients with signs of ischemia both in stress test and in Holter recording are considered out of 491 who had undergone coronary surgery. Ischemia during 24 hr Holter monitoring develops at an heart rate lower than effort ischemia. Holter monitoring proves to be very useful also in patients after valvular replacement to study arrhythmias and to check drugs' efficacy. After displaying the results concerning arrhythmias of 24 hr Holter electrocardiograms recorded in 207 randomized patients who had undergone valvular replacement 15 days before, the authors dwell upon the use of Holter electrocardiography in 82 valvular patients after pharmacological cardioversion and show that major arrhythmias get a clear reduction thanks to rehabilitation.
The first approach to treatment of dyslipidaemia is with diet. Currently, modified soybean protein is often included in the diet. A study was made of 32 patients with types IIa and IIb dyslipidaemia to see what changes in blood lipids could be induced by a simple low fat diet and a diet with modified soybean protein substituted for part of the animal protein. After six weeks on the initial low fat diet, all of the patients had lower total cholesterol and triglyceride levels, but there were no significant changes in the high density lipoprotein-cholesterol levels. The same diet was continued for eight weeks by 19 of the patients, who continued to improve. The 13 patients who had shown the least response to the initial simple low protein diet were given a diet in which the animal protein was partially replaced with modified soybean protein. This diet further decreased the total cholesterol.
The effectiveness of Nitroderm TTS 5 and Nitroderm TTS 10 in stable effort-induced angina pectoris was assessed by measuring the tolerance of 20 selected in-patients to cycloergometric symptom-limited tests. During the week preceding the trial previous anti-anginal treatment was gradually withdrawn except for short-acting nitrates. Patients were also familiarized with ergometric laboratory environment. The trial started with a 24-h control period when placebo was given single-blind to each patient. A double-blind cross-over design was then followed, two groups of 10 patients each being subjected successively to two sequences of therapy. By means of the double-dummy technique, Nitroderm TTS 5 or Nitroderm TTS 10 and matching placebos were applied simultaneously once daily for 24 h on two different days. Resting heart rate and blood pressure were measured before starting each exercise test, which was performed 3 h after placebo as well as 3 and 24 h after Nitroderm TTS application. The results of the tests were evaluated in terms of maximum workload, duration of exercise and total work performed for each of the two doses administered and compared with the corresponding baseline values. When compared with placebo both Nitroderm TTS doses produced a significant change (P less than 0.01) in the assessment variables. After application of the active treatment, duration of exercise, total work performed and maximal workload were increased while lying and standing blood pressures were decreased. The present investigation was undertaken to evaluate the effects of Dilazep, a new antiplatelet and coronary dilating drug, on the exercise tolerance of patients who had suffered previous myocardial infarction and were participating in a cardiac rehabilitation programme. Seventy-two patients were enrolled in the study. They were randomly allocated to two groups of 36 subjects; patients in group A took Dilazep, 300 mg daily; patients in group B took acetylsalicylic acid, 100 mg daily, or dipyridamole, 300 mg daily. Before and after treatment all patients underwent two maximal or symptom limited cycloergometer stress tests, respectively 30 and 60 days after the episode of acute myocardial infarction. Total exercise time, maximum workload reached, heart rate, blood pressure, double product and oxygen pulse were measured. In both groups a significant increase in both total exercise time and maximum workload reached was recorded at the second stress test; this may reflect a greater degree of physical conditioning due to the rehabilitation programme. In group A patients total exercise time increased from 457.12 +/- 5.36 sec to 588.28 +/- 8.24 sec (p less than 0.005), in group B patients it increased from 459.18 +/- 6.11 sec to 547.43 +/- 7.47 sec (p less than 0.005). The mean values of maximum workload reached increased in group A from 4512.14 +/- 116.47 kgm to 5288.57 +/- 145.38 kgm (p less than 0.005), and in group B from 4522.22 +/- 108.42 kgm to 5098 +/- 137.51 kgm (p less than 0.005).
